Secondhand smoke is associated with disease and premature deaths in non-smoking adults and children. Exposure to secondhand smoke irritates the airways and has an immediate harmful effect on person’s heart and blood vessels. People next to a smoker can get harmful chemicals in their body too. When you breathe in smoke which comes from the end of lit cigarette, or that is exhaled by a smoker, you are inhaling almost the same amount of chemicals as the smoker breathes in. One example of secondhand smoke is when one person in a house smokes, and everybody else including children inhale the smoke.     The health risks of smoking are not worth getting that good feeling from nicotine. Cigarettes are filled with other chemicals besides the nicotine you’re seeking, and those chemicals can do very bad things to your body. There are over 7,000 chemical compounds in cigarettes, more than 250 of these are known to be harmful, and at least 69 are known to be cancer causing (Secondhand Smoke). There is also tar in cigarettes that coats a smoker’s lungs more and more every time they take a puff, and that’s what makes it so hard to breathe. Smoking cigarettes is related to several types of cancers that cause the deaths of millions of people each year.…
